Importance Of the Church In Our Lives

The need for the Church to our lives is similar to water to the land. Without water, everything would shrivel as well as die - without the Church, spiritually, you may shrivel and die. Sometime ago, the Church was being a safe haven. People would go to hear the Word, be saved, confess sins and renew their strength and to become closer to God. At this point, you find all sorts of things taking place in this home of worship until people seem to have forgotten the need for the Church in their lives.

Life has several trials and even though you could have the family and also social structure to support you, inside, you are still able to feel alone. Can you explain that? With no Church in our lives, we rob ourselves of what our spirit needs the most - constant teachings to help keep us on level ground. Frequently, you hear the excuse for not going to Church being that it holds a number of hypocrites and who want to go sit for hours. People will be people and you will find hypocrites in every social arena you are a part of, but the most important thing to remember is that the Church is where you are constantly encouraged to grow spiritually.

The Church is where are able to go and teach the other, honor one another, encourage one another, and above all, love one another. How could you use your spiritual gifts if you can't attend Church? It is truly written that any of us to help fellow Christians, and the Church is often where you can come up with thoughts and plan as 'one body' to help hundreds of people at one time.

Certainly one of this would be the homeless. You will recognize that almost any Church does its best to reach out to the homeless and this may come by way of preparing hot meals and serving them or even providing grooming services while adding the spiritual guidance needed, trying to change or encourage a life. Should you be not in a Church, you are not part of the solution, this means you have really lost touch with the importance of the Church in your life. Think about learning a new phone number -it takes repeating it a couple of times before it will sink in. It's the same for learning the Word - if you don't hear it as often, you lose it and you lose your spirituality.
